WebJun 13, 2024 · The cisterns, both open and closed, ensured that the accumulated rainwater was used after being stored cleanly. Cisterns were used to store fresh water rather than salt water. It is estimated that there are about 70 cisterns in Istanbul, although their exact number is not known. These 70 cisterns are thought to be from the Byzantine period. WebCistern [N] [S] the rendering of a Hebrew word bor , which means a receptacle for water conveyed to it; distinguished from beer , which denotes a place where water rises on the … WebMar 1, 2010 · Step 2 - Calculate Your Water Consumption. To have a cistern as a back up supply you will need to find out how much water you generally consume in an average day. There are a few methods to do this. The easiest way is to simply look at a water bill. Take the number of gallons used over a month and divide it by 30.

Webcisterns, cesspools, septic tanks, and other holes. This bul-letin presents the best procedures to eliminate these holes. Origin of cisterns, cesspools and other holes Historically, homes located where groundwater was not readily available depended heavily on roof runoff col-lection and cistern storage for household water.
